WebDec 31, 2024 · Consuming too many tannins can increase your risk of iron deficiency anemia. In one study, healthy adults experienced a 37% decrease in iron absorption after drinking tea with an iron-rich porridge. However, the participants did not have any effects on iron absorption when drinking tea one hour after eating. [24]

By reducing nutrient bioavailability, tannic acid reduces the nutritional value of foodstuffs (Sharma et al., … WebFoods and drinks that reduce your body’s ability to absorb iron: Soy proteins can reduce absorption from plant sources. Tea, coffee and wine contain tannins that reduce iron absorption by binding to the iron and carrying it out of the body. Phytates and fibres found in wholegrains such as bran can reduce the absorption of iron and other minerals.
